How they compare
Serbia currently reports 8.5% against 7.1% in Lithuania, a difference of 1.4%.
That makes Serbia's figure about 1.2 times Lithuania's.
Across all 12 years both countries report, Serbia has been ahead every year.
Lithuania ranks 22nd and Serbia ranks 19th of 47 countries.
Serbia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
